Frans van Winden is a professor of economics at the Amsterdam School of Economics and a principal investigator at the Cognitive Science Center Amsterdam, part of the University of Amsterdam. He was the founding director of CREED from 1991 to 2011 and served as co-director from 1987 to 1992. In addition to his academic roles, he is a member of the board of the Tinbergen Institute and has held visiting positions at prestigious institutions including the California Institute of Technology, Harvard University, CES (Munich), Zentrum für interdisziplinäre Forschung (Bielefeld), and UCLA. He is a fellow of the Center for Economic Policy Research (CEPR), CESifo, and the Tinbergen Institute. Van Winden is currently on the editorial board of Public Choice, emphasizing his active engagement in academic publishing and research dissemination. His primary research interests encompass political economics, behavioral economics, neuroeconomics, and experimental economics, reflecting a diverse engagement with contemporary issues in economic theory and practice.
